Hello all

I am wondering if the 150 hour pic time is a requirement that is set in stone, or something that could be overlooked with other experience?

eg. A king air FO with well over 1500 hours but 120 pic...

The 150 is a firm requirement. I was in a similar boat in that I needed more PIC time. I approached WJE with options but the black and white answer was “...thou shalt have the required PIC mins”. It is set is very hard granite.

Alright, stop nickel and dimming your hours like some kid who’s counting enough pennies to buy a candy bar... okay that was sarcasm but there is some truth to this. Do yourself and passengers a favour and get some real world PIC before getting a left seat job in a 705..what’s the rush getting to encore with 1000 hours..?? Get your ATPL in 703/4 and then go there. I fly with way too many FOs who do this and a year later write to me asking if I know any PIC jobs because they don’t have enough money to rent a plane or their company does not provide picus and I tell them every time...should have gotten your PIC on the multi before you hopped the fence.
